Fewer Quebecers infected with COVID in our hospitals

Patients infected with COVID are on the decline in Quebec, which has a balance sheet of 3,270 people in its hospitals, including 252 patients in intensive care.

The province also deplores 73 new deaths bringing the total number of victims of the coronavirus to 13,009 since the start of the pandemic.

THE SITUATION IN QUEBEC AS OF JANUARY 26, 2022

– 845,564 people infected (+4,150)*

– 13,009 deaths (+73)

– 3270 people hospitalized

*297 entries

*305 outputs

– 252 people in intensive care

*31 entries

*42 outputs

– 86,062 doses administered are added, that is 80,131 in the last 24 hours and 5,931 before January 25, for a total of 17,337,953 doses administered in Quebec.

– Outside Quebec, a total of 270,569 doses were administered, for a cumulative total of 17,608,522 doses received by Quebecers.

* The number of cases listed is not representative of the situation since access to screening centers is restricted to priority clienteles
